Esempio n. 1
0
 /**
  * @dataProvider fileProvider
  */
 public function testCrop($file_path)
 {
     $image = new fImage($file_path);
     $new_image = $image->duplicate('output/');
     list($base, $extension) = explode('.', $new_image->getName());
     $new_image->rename($base . FILE_PREFIX . '_crop_300x300-200x200.' . $extension, FALSE);
     $new_image->crop(300, 300, 200, 200);
     $new_image->saveChanges();
 }
Esempio n. 2
0
 public function testFilename()
 {
     if (stripos(php_uname('s'), 'windows') !== FALSE) {
         $this->markTestSkipped();
     }
     $image = new fImage('resources/images/filename_test.gif');
     $new_image = $image->duplicate('output/');
     $new_image->rename('1::6df23dc03f9b54cc38a0fc1483df6e21.gif', TRUE);
     $new_image->rotate(90);
     $new_image->saveChanges();
 }